The Role: Social Manager - DAZN

As

Social Manager – DAZN , you will be responsible for

leading the team of internal content creators dedicated to covering DAZN’s key company priorities across boxing, football, NFL, and other major rights .

Sitting within the

Social team

and reporting into the

VP of Social & Content , this role focuses on

strategy, programming, and people management across multiple social handles . You will ensure the internal multisport creator team is flexible and effectively deployed to support

sport‑specific priority handles

(e.g. Boxing, Football, NFL), while also programming and contributing to the

@DAZN

handle as a supporting, cross‑sport channel.

This is a player‑coach role requiring strong editorial judgement across multiple sports, clear leadership, and the ability to still create and publish content when needed.

This role will be based primarily in our New York office, working shifts across Monday - Sunday.

What You'll Be Doing:

Lead and manage the

internal multisport Social Content Creator team

aligned to DAZN’s key company priorities

Plan and coordinate coverage across

sport‑specific priority handles

(Boxing, Football, NFL) and the

@DAZN

handle

Own the programming strategy for the multisport team, ensuring creators are scheduled effectively across key events, fights, and matchdays

Program the

@DAZN

handle to amplify major moments and stories across DAZN’s rights portfolio

Ensure the team can flex across sports depending on the calendar, priorities, and live moments

Act as an editorial decision‑maker during live events, ensuring fast, accurate, and platform‑native publishing

Create content yourself — filming, editing, posting, and clipping live feeds

Work closely with sport‑specific social leads, Editorial, Creative, Marketing, and Production teams

Use performance insights to optimise coverage plans, internal creator deployment, and content mix

What You'll Bring:

Proven experience leading social teams within sports or media environments

Strong multi‑sport editorial knowledge, including boxing, football, NFL, and other major sports

Experience managing

internal content creators

and scheduling coverage across multiple simultaneous priorities

Clear understanding of how sport‑specific social handles and generalist brand handles work together

Confidence creating end‑to‑end social content alongside your team

Strong strategic thinking paired with hands‑on execution

Deep understanding of social programming, live coverage, and platform dynamics

Calm, decisive leadership in fast‑paced, live sports environments
